run is a universal multi-language runner and smart REPL (Read-Eval-Print Loop) written in Rust. It provides a unified interface for executing code across 25 programming languages without the hassle of ...
Computer science higher education must embrace GenAI and reinvent teaching methods and learning materials, or risk becoming ...
Explore the origins, evolution, and significance of coding from ancient machines to modern programming languages in today's digital world.
Fireship on MSN

C in 100 seconds

The C Programming Language is quite possibly the most influential language of all time. It powers OS kernels like Linux, ...
Parts of the brain are "rewired" when people learn computer programming, according to new research. Scientists watched ...
AMHERST — Caminantes, the dual-language Spanish and English program at Fort River School, will expand into sixth grade next fall when all Amherst sixth graders move to the Amherst Regional Middle ...
Automatic translators can facilitate migration from C to Rust, but existing translators generate unsatisfactory code by ...
Researchers at Edera say they have uncovered a critical boundary-parsing bug, dubbed TARmageddon ( CVE-2025-62518 ), in the popular async-tar Rust library. And not only is it in this library, but also ...
Abstract: Large language models (LLMs) have achieved impressive performance in code generation recently, offering programmers revolutionary assistance in software development. However, due to the auto ...
The dreams of middle school students; hundreds of works by SC artists; Catawba pottery and river cane weaves. Three projects ...
In a budding partnership, a dozen students visited the school to learn more about its focus on community-involved learning, immersion in Ojibwe language and culture, and teach some lessons.
While Python continues to be the runaway leader in Tiobe’s monthly index of programming language popularity, C, C++, and Java are engaged in a fierce battle for second place. Currently in fifth place, ...